- Long ago people used to call their fields after some person, place or thing. It was commonly known in our locality. Daddy told me that old Cassie Brodbin called some of her fields after some place. He did not tell me the name of the place. Here are some of the names of the field’s. The Árdan [?] Páirc it was called that name because it is all high rocks. The poll a phreachain. It was called that name because long ago crows used to make(continues on next page)
